U.S. stock indexes were mixed in the first hours of trading Friday.

The Dow Jones Industrial Average is down a small amount, while the Standard & Poor’s 500 index is up two-tenths of a percent and the NASDAQ by one-half of a percentage point.

European stock markets are lower in afternoon trading.

London’s Financial Times 100 index is down six-tenths of a percent. The CAC-40 in Paris is off 1.9 percent and the DAX in Frankfurt by two-tenths of a percent.

In Asia, Tokyo’s Nikkei index lost seven-tenths of a percent , to close at 9,833.

Hong Kong’s Hang Seng index dropped six-tenths of a percent , to end at 22,440.

Gold advanced $8.24 to trade at $1,624.19 an ounce.

The U.S. dollar was lower against both the euro and yen.
